
Aztec Electronics has developed the battery backup system for use with Motorola's micro-cell hardware on GSM networks. The purpose of the unit is to provide sufficient DC backup power in order to maintain network availability.
Aztec's Microcell Battery Backup unit contains two sealed lead-acid NorthStar NSB90FT batteries and is capable of supplying backup power to a single micro-cell transceiver for approximately 14 hours, or to two micro-cell transceivers for approximately 7 hours. The unit also contains an integrated switched-mode charger with LED indication and a 22 V low power drain voltage regulator as well as current and voltage meters.
The Microcell Battery Backup unit is wall mountable, lockable and protected against direct sunlight by its reflective outer heat shields.
